Re: Moving all regions and tempo/meter info at same time
You can just drag the "Song Start" marker...
It's the same red "diamond" that you double-clicked to change the tempo. Click+drag it to the right until your session starts when you want it to. Seriously, I thought a lot of people knew that...

Re: Moving all regions and tempo/meter info at same time
in the tempo meter window above the tracks select all tempos then holding shift grab the first tempo from the green bar below in that tempo meter window and move around. move all tracks around like normal also with grouping or selecting all and holding shift.

Re: Moving all regions and tempo/meter info at same time
Change all tracks to tick. If it's in sample it won't move. Highlight. Move by clicking on the tempo marker. Also I don't think you have to but change all audio tracks to there suitable choice of elastic audio.
